Registering a business branch abroad
– what do you need to know?
To register a business branch abroad, several formalities need to be completed. The branch must have a registered address and, in some countries, a physical office. A business branch abroad is a separate and independent organisational part of an enterprise in its home country but does not have a separate legal personality from the parent company. The branch may incur obligations on behalf of the parent company. You should keep in mind that a registered business branch abroad is not in itself a separate legal entity; it cannot function entirely separately from the parent company, so its activity remains closely linked to the activity in the country of registration of the parent entity.
What do you need
to register a business branch abroad?
Registering our business branch abroad usually requires learning about the rules and standards applicable in the country where we will be registering our business branch abroad. In addition, we have to take into account the implementation of the reciprocity principle, determine the competent court register for registering a business branch abroad, and the elements of the motion to enter a business branch abroad.
